Details

In the highly anticipated fourth installment of the Twilight Saga, a marriage, a honeymoon, and the birth of a child bring unforeseen and shocking developments for Bella and Edward and those they love, including new complications with young werewolf Jacob Black.

Publisher: Universal City, CA : - Summit Entertainment
Edition: Two disc special ed
Language: English and Spanish
Contents: [disc 1]. Theatrical movie
[disc 2]. Special features.
Credits: Music by Carter Burwell ; costume designer, Michael Wilkinson ; editor, Virginia Katz ; director of photography, Guillermo Navarro.
Performers: Kristen Stewart, Robert Pattinson, Taylor Lautner, Billy Burke, Peter Facinelli, Elizabeth Reaser, Kellan Lutz, Nikki Reed, Jackson Rathbone, Ashley Greene.
Suitability:
MPAA rating PG-13 for disturbing images, violence, sexualitypartial nudity and some thematic elements
Notes: DVD, NTSC, Region 1, anamorphic widescreen (2.40:1) aspect ratio, Dolby Digital 5.1, DVS 2.0.
English or Spanish dialogue; English SDH or Spanish subtitles. Audio description in English for the visually impaired.
Based on the book by Stephanie Meyer.
Special features: 6-part making-of documentary; wedding video; Jacob's destiny; Edward fast forward and Jacob fast forward; audio commentary.
Statement of responsibility: Summit Entertainment presents a Temple Hill production in association with Sunswept Entertainment ; produced by Wyck Godfrey, Karen Rosenfelt, Stephanie Meyer ; screenplay by Melissa Rosenberg ; directed by Bill Condon
Physical description: 2 videodiscs (117 min.) : sd., col. ; 4 3/4 in.
